Chi usa TCP?

Domanda di: Dr. Maruska Basile  |  Ultimo aggiornamento: 10 dicembre 2021
Valutazione: 4.2/5 (53 voti)

In genere il TCP viene utilizzato per quelle applicazioni che richiedono un servizio orientato alla connessione, come ad esempio la posta elettronica e il file sharing, mentre l'UDP prende sempre più piede per le applicazioni in tempo reale come l'on-line gaming o lo streaming audio e video; la differenza fra i due ...

Come viene aperta una connessione TCP?

Per aprire una connessione TCP, come già detto, è necessario il meccanismo del Three-Way Handshake. Se il client che ha chiesto di instaurare una connessione non risponde al server con il pacchetto di ACK dopo che ha ricevuto il relativo SYN-ACK, il server rimarrà in attesa.

Come funziona il protocollo TCP?

TCP (Transmission Control Protocol): si incarica di suddividere le informazioni in pacchetti e di garantire il buon fine della trasmissione dati tra due stazioni. Se nel tragitto un pacchetto viene perso, si “preoccupa” di ritrasmettere rapidamente al destinatario l'informazione andata persa nei meandri della rete.

Che differenza c'è tra UDP e TCP?

Tra i protocolli più utilizzati vi sono UDP (User Datagram Protocol) e TCP (Transmission Control Protocol). Entrambi si poggiano sul protocollo IP. Una prima differenza tra TCP e UDP consiste nel fatto che il primo è un protocollo orientato alla connessione, mentre il secondo è un protocollo senza connessione.

Cosa sono le connessioni TCP?

Il protocollo TCP crea la connessione tra due host e gestisce la consegna dei pacchetti da un sistema all'altro, mentre il protocollo IP fornisce le istruzioni per il trasferimento dei dati.

TCP e UDP - Protocolli di trasporto a confronto



Trovate 45 domande correlate

Quali sono le fasi che portano alla creazione di una connessione?

Connessioni di rete. ... Queste tipologie di connessioni avvengono attraverso fasi distinte tra loro comprendenti la fase di instaurazione, espletamento del servizio di comunicazione tra utenti o apparati di rete (sessione) ed infine l'abbattimento della connessione.

Cosa si intende per protocollo di rete?

I protocolli sono un insieme di regole utilizzate dalle due macchine per scambiarsi informazioni e specifica cosa deve essere comunicato, in che modo e quando. Se le due macchine sono remote, si parla di protocollo di rete.

Perché TCP è affidabile?

TCP è altamente affidabile, poiché utilizza l'handshake a 3 vie, il flusso, gli errori e il controllo della congestione. Si assicura che i dati inviati dal computer di origine vengano ricevuti accuratamente dal computer di destinazione. Se nel caso, i dati ricevuti non sono nel formato corretto, TCP ritrasmette i dati.

Quali servizi noti utilizzano UDP e quali TCP?

Come alternativa snella e quasi senza ritardi rispetto a TCP, UDP viene impiegato per la trasmissione rapida di pacchetti di dati nelle reti IP. I settori di impiego tipici di UDP sono pertanto richieste DNS, connessioni VPN e streaming audio/video.

Quando si usa UDP?

UDP viene utilizzato quando la velocità di rete è elevata e può essere superflue il controllo di errori. Ad esempio, UDP è spesso utilizzato per li video in diretta in streaming e per i giochi online. Un video in streaming in diretta è un flusso di dati continuo che viene inviato al computer.

Quale tra le seguenti applicazioni usa il protocollo TCP?

In genere il TCP viene utilizzato per quelle applicazioni che richiedono un servizio orientato alla connessione, come ad esempio la posta elettronica e il file sharing, mentre l'UDP prende sempre più piede per le applicazioni in tempo reale come l'on-line gaming o lo streaming audio e video; la differenza fra i due ...

Come viene identificato univocamente un socket TCP?

Un socket di questo tipo è identificato dalla terna protocollo di trasporto, indirizzo IP del computer, numero di porta; ... Un socket di questo tipo è identificato dalla 5-tupla protocollo di trasporto, indirizzo IP sorgente, indirizzo IP destinazione, numero di porta sorgente, numero di porta destinazione.

Cosa succede nel protocollo TCP Transmission Control Protocol In caso di congestione della rete?

In presenza di congestione nella rete, le code nei router diventano più lunghe, e questo fa aumentare il ritardo subito dai pacchetti e dai relativi riscontri, e quindi l'RTT.

Qual è la relazione tra un datagramma IP è un frame ethernet?

Un datagramma IP, quando viene passato al livello fisico, viene incapsulato in un header Ethernet per formare un frame fisico. Il problema è che le dimensioni massime di questo frame sono limitate. Il valore di questo limite è chiamato MTU, maximum transfer unit (unità massima di trasferimento).

Qual è la relazione tra TCP e IP?

TCP (Transmission Control Protocol) è un protocollo a livello di trasporto che, una volta stabilita una connessione, procede con l'inoltro e il controllo dei dati da un terminale all'altro. Si appoggia sul protocollo IP per trasportare i pacchetti di dati e migliora la garanzia di “consegna” delle informazioni.

Che cos'è il protocollo TCP IP e quali sono le sue caratteristiche?

TCP/IP: il TCP/IP è un gruppo di protocolli che costituiscono il fondamento di Internet e di altre reti. Il nome TCP/IP è formato dai due protocolli determinanti per la comunicazione in Internet: il Transmission Control Protocol (TCP) e l'Internet Protocol (IP).

Che tipo di applicazioni sono più adatte per l'utilizzo di UDP?

Molte applicazioni risultano più adatte ad un protocollo UDP per i seguenti motivi: Controllo più sottile a livello di applicazione su quali dati sono inviati e quando: non appena un processo applicativo passa dati a UDP, quest'ultimo li impacchetta in un segmento che trasferisce immediatamente al livello di rete.

Quali sono le caratteristiche principali del protocollo UDP che lo rendono preferibile al protocollo TCP in determinate applicazioni *?

L'UDP è un protocollo stateless, ovvero non tiene nota dello stato della connessione dunque ha, rispetto al TCP, meno informazioni da memorizzare: un server dedicato ad una particolare applicazione che scelga UDP come protocollo di trasporto può supportare quindi molti più client attivi.

A quale livello lavorano TCP e UDP?

TCP e UDP sono protocolli utilizzati per l'invio di bit di dati, noti come pacchetti. Sono entrambi posti al livello immediatamente superiore al protocollo internet IP, quindi, se si sta inviando un pacchetto tramite TCP o UDP, quel pacchetto viene inviato sicuramente a un indirizzo IP.

Quali sono i livelli del modello TCP IP?

Il documento sul protocollo TCP/IP è indentificato con la sigla RFC 1180. Nel confronto tra ISO/OSI e TCP/IP si evidenzia la semplicità di quest'ultimo modello: esso si basa su quattro livelli: Host to Network Access layer , Internet layer, Transport Layer, Application Layer.

Cosa fa il livello di trasporto?

Il livello di trasporto verifica che i pacchetti vengano riordinati nella giusta sequenza in ricezione prima di passarli al livello superiore. ... Se gli host coinvolti nella comunicazione hanno prestazioni molto differenti può capitare che un pc più veloce "inondi" di dati uno più lento portando alla perdita di pacchetti.

Cosa succede se tolgo la connessione dati?

Ora seleziona la voce Utilizzo dati. Non trovi questa voce? Se stai usando una vecchia versione del sistema Android, i passaggi per disabilitare la connessione dati sono diversi. Nel paragrafo successivo ti spiego come disattivare la connessione dati sui vecchi smartphone e tablet.

Chi utilizza gli indirizzi IP per inoltrare il traffico da una rete ad altre?

Il routing è l'instradamento effettuato a livello di rete. Nel caso tipico di IP, i router usano tabelle di instradamento i cui elementi sono blocchi di indirizzi IP contigui, che sono detti route o rotte.

Come si progetta una rete LAN?

Per creare una LAN, ti serve un router o uno switch, che agirà da snodo. Questi dispositivi indirizzano le informazioni ai computer giusti. Un router assegna automaticamente l'indirizzo IP a tutti i dispositivi della rete ed è necessario per accedere a internet.

Qual è il protocollo affidabile di trasporto e cosa significa che è affidabile?

Possiamo dire che il protocollo TCP è colui che garantisce un controllo della trasmissione affidabile. E' un protocollo presente solo sugli host di trasmissione e ricezione e non sugli altri nodi della rete.

Articolo precedente
Quanto tempo ci vuole per la notifica della cittadinanza?
Articolo successivo
Quale legno usare per fare un tagliere?